A bright future for the grey metals<br />
Alternative metals have opened up the world of fashion jewellery<br />
to many different price demographics as jewellers and designers<br />
use new and non-traditional materials to create their pieces. This<br />
makes for an exciting time for jewellers and jewellery lovers alike.<br />
Indeed Jamie believes the future in this field is very exciting and<br />
full of opportunity.<br />
“We have only scratched the surface of how alternative metal<br />
can be used and the materials we are using,” he said. “There may<br />
come a day that it would no longer be tagged as alternative.”<br />
Cudworth Enterprises, which this year celebrates 100 years<br />
since the original company was registered, offers a wide range<br />
of products in alternative metals and believes the growth in the<br />
sector will continue.<br />

“So long as alternative metal jewellery<br />
maintains strong design and quality,<br />
the future looks very strong,” said<br />
Darren. “We offer the largest range<br />
in Australia with a full range of<br />
categories of stainless steel jewellery<br />
with matching pieces.”<br />
The days of ‘the other metals’ only<br />
being used in offerings of men’s rings<br />
are definitely over but the staples will<br />
always be on trend.<br />
“Cufflinks, bangles and rings will<br />
always look good in alternative<br />
metals,” said Darren.<br />
The alternative metal jewellery sales at Ellani Collections have<br />
seen strong growth, and Paul said he cannot see it slowing down<br />
in popularity.<br />
